< Amos Propheta 2 >
1 haec dicit Dominus super tribus sceleribus Moab et super quattuor non convertam eum eo quod incenderit ossa regis Idumeae usque ad cinerem
These are the words of the Lord: For three crimes of Moab, and for four, I will not let its fate be changed; because he had the bones of the king of Edom burned to dust.
2 et mittam ignem in Moab et devorabit aedes Carioth et morietur in sonitu Moab in clangore tubae
And I will send a fire on Moab, burning up the great houses of Kerioth: and death will come on Moab with noise and outcries and the sound of the horn:
3 et disperdam iudicem de medio eius et omnes principes eius interficiam cum eo dicit Dominus
And I will have the judge cut off from among them, and all their captains I will put to death with him, says the Lord.
4 haec dicit Dominus super tribus sceleribus Iuda et super quattuor non convertam eum eo quod abiecerint legem Domini et mandata eius non custodierint deceperunt enim eos idola sua post quae abierant patres eorum
These are the words of the Lord: For three crimes of Judah, and for four, I will not let its fate be changed; because they have given up the law of the Lord, and have not kept his rules; and their false ways, in which their fathers went, have made them go out of the right way.
5 et mittam ignem in Iuda et devorabit aedes Hierusalem
And I will send a fire on Judah, burning up the great houses of Jerusalem.
6 haec dicit Dominus super tribus sceleribus Israhel et super quattuor non convertam eum pro eo quod vendiderit argento iustum et pauperem pro calciamentis
These are the words of the Lord: For three crimes of Israel, and for four, I will not let its fate be changed; because they have given the upright man for silver, and the poor for the price of two shoes;
7 qui conterunt super pulverem terrae capita pauperum et viam humilium declinant et filius ac pater eius ierunt ad puellam ut violarent nomen sanctum meum
Crushing the head of the poor, and turning the steps of the gentle out of the way: and a man and his father go in to the same young woman, putting shame on my holy name:
8 et super vestimentis pigneratis accubuerunt iuxta omne altare et vinum damnatorum bibebant in domo Dei sui
By every altar they are stretched on clothing taken from those who are in their debt, drinking in the house of their god the wine of those who have made payment for wrongdoing.
9 ego autem exterminavi Amorreum a facie eorum cuius altitudo cedrorum altitudo eius et fortis ipse quasi quercus et contrivi fructum eius desuper et radices eius subter
Though I sent destruction on the Amorite before them, who was tall as the cedar and strong as the oak-tree, cutting off his fruit from on high and his roots from under the earth.
10 ego sum qui ascendere vos feci de terra Aegypti et eduxi vos in deserto quadraginta annis ut possideretis terram Amorrei
And I took you up out of the land of Egypt, guiding you for forty years in the waste land, so that you might take for your heritage the land of the Amorite.
11 et suscitavi de filiis vestris in prophetas et de iuvenibus vestris nazarenos numquid non ita est filii Israhel dicit Dominus
And some of your sons I made prophets, and some of your young men I made separate for myself. Is it not even so, O children of Israel? says the Lord.
12 et propinabatis nazarenis vino et prophetis mandabatis dicentes ne prophetetis
But to those who were separate you gave wine for drink; and to the prophets you said, Be prophets no longer.
13 ecce ego stridebo super vos sicut stridet plaustrum onustum faeno
See, I am crushing you down, as one is crushed under a cart full of grain.
14 et peribit fuga a veloce et fortis non obtinebit virtutem suam et robustus non salvabit animam suam
And flight will be impossible for the quick-footed, and the force of the strong will become feeble, and the man of war will not get away safely:
15 et tenens arcum non stabit et velox pedibus suis non salvabitur et ascensor equi non salvabit animam suam
And the bowman will not keep his place; he who is quick-footed will not get away safely: and the horseman will not keep his life.
16 et robustus corde inter fortes nudus fugiet in die illa dicit Dominus
And he who is without fear among the fighting men will go in flight without his clothing in that day, says the Lord.
